Shifts in Industry/Regulations

Landscape is Changing and User Expectations Rising

Regulatory Changes

Regulations such as GDPR, CCPA have impacted how data can be collected and used

Brower Updates

Heightened controls are impacting traditional data collection (e.g., third-party cookies and device identifiers)

User Privacy Controls

Users are demanding more control and transparency over data collected and used for ads personalization

GA4 USER TRACKING

GA4 Tracking Options:
Device IDs, Google Signals & User IDs

Devices IDs

Device id generates a random integer stored by a first-party cookie
making the user anonymous. Saved for two years after first stored.
*Does not allow for cross-device tracking

Google Signals*

Google signals requires users are logged into their google account and given consent allowing GA4 to associate users with the event data it collects. Google Signals uses aggregate data, so personal data is anonymized and never processed by third parties. Personal user personal data is protected and is GDPR and other privacy laws compliant.
*Requires average of 500 Users Per Day

User IDs

User id requires users login to their account and is the most reliable method of tracking individual users across multiple devices, without cookies, it only works if users are authenticated or logged into your website/app during each session.

GA4 Privacy Consent Mode

Google Consent Mode is a way for your website to measure conversions and get analytics insights while being fully GDPR, CCPA, LGPD compliant across Google Analytics, Google Tag Manager (GTM) and Google Ads.
Google’s privacy consent mode permit websites to honor the individual user’s consent preferences while still collecting anonymized metrics. It does not help target or identify users, but captures anonymous data reporting on content, conversions, and attribution which helps Google to model for gaps in conversions.
Google Consent Mode integrates with OneTrust, privacy management software.

User Engagement Metrics

Understanding User Behavior

GA4 metrics use events to measure engagement and give a well-rounded view of website visitor behaviors and actions.
Allow you to know exactly how your website visitors interacted with your content.

Analysis Hub

What Does the Analysis Hub Do?

Analysis Hub is a collection of advanced analysis techniques to help you uncover deeper insights into your customers’ behaviors that go beyond the standard reports.
